MyFriendLuke182 Posted January 14, 2017 Report Share Posted January 14, 2017 Hey guys, I'm thinking about buying a new guitar. I kinda want a guitar that is more suited for playing punk rock, hardcore, pop punk. I was thinking about buying a fender jazzmaster or a jaguar with humbuckers. But I am not really experienced when it comes to guitar tones, so i don't really know if it is the right decision. Do you guys have any suggestions? I would really appreciate it. Ghost Posted January 14, 2017 Report Share Posted January 14, 2017 I'd go for a Les Paul without a doubt. And, about the tone and the pickups just worry not that much. Well, of course you have to know what ones you want to be on your guitar and what sound do they make, but don't forget that a lot of the tone thing is something that has to do with the amp/cabinet you get, pedals and stuff. If you can, go to a store, play some Fenders and Gibsons, and ask the guys all the things you want to know. I'm not sure if Jaguars and Jazzmasters are the ones to go when talking about punkock (sure Skiba uses the Jaguar, and Cobain used it too), but you have t pay attention on the whole rig.
